The surface type of tennis court repair that have been completed on a sports area within the UK include:

  • Hard-Court – Macadam surfacing repairs including re-surfacing or recap of porous tarmac sports court surface and line marking over the existing macadam flooring.

  • Synthetic Clay Surfacing Repair – Infill of new tennis flooring for a neater smoother finish.

  • Synthetic Grass Surfacing Repair – Resurfacing of a macadam or existing sand filled grass surfaces that have become compacted, filled with dirt and lost its porosity and permeable nature.

  • Polymeric – Rubberised surfacing repairs including recap of existing with a rubber EPDM surface.

On macadam courts or polymeric courts it is possible that fretting surfaces can be professionally repaired by applying a binder course to the surface to bond any loose aggregates to the flooring before an acrylic or polyurethane anti slip paint specialists coating is applied to the surface to ensure that the sports facility meets the non-slip requirements of the ITF, LTA and SAPCA (TRRL 55 SR 55)

How to Repair Cracks in Tennis Courts in Port Sgiogarstaigh

If you're looking at how to fix cracks in nearby sports courts closest to you, our company have years of experience within the industry and can carry out basic repairs to improve your facility. 

  1. Clean the surface thoroughly so dirt is removed from the cracks

  2. Apply a chemical treatment to remove and prevent contamination

  3. Fill in cracks with 2mm emerald stone mixed with polyurethane binder

  4. Install a polyurethane binder coat to strengthen the existing surface

  5. Paint the flooring with an anti slip paint colour coating to hide the repairs which have been completed

  6. Apply line markings to your court for accurate gameplay. 

We can complete minor repairs along with a specialist clean and paint to dramatically enhance the look and play of your sports surface and improve slip resistance.

Cost to Resurface a Tennis Court UK

If you're interested to know the cost to resurface a local tennis court, we can provide you with a free quotation specific to your facility.

There is no fixed price when it comes to resurfacing a sports facility, as a number of different factors can alter the cost.

Firstly, the size of your facility and surrounding areas will obviously make a difference to the cost; if you've got a single court, the price to resurface it will be much cheaper than someone who has triple or double tennis courts.

Additionally, you may decide you want to completely change the surfacing. Upgrading a macadam court to a polymeric facility will not be the same price as upgrading a polymeric facility to a synthetic turf pitch.
